Despite the availability of State Children's Health Insurance Program, families often fail to obtain coverage for eligible children because:
 
  1. They believe their income is too high to qualify.
  2. They do not see the importance of insurance coverage.
  3. Families do not have adequate time to complete the enrollment process.
  4. Parents do not value medical interventions for their children.

Answer to Question 1

1
Rationale:
1. Despite availability of SCHIP, many eligible children are not enrolled. Reasons families have not enrolled include belief that their income is too high to qualify; they have obtained other insurance; they have difficulty with the application process and required documentation; and they lack skills in negotiating the system to get coverage.
2. Most families do value insurance coverage, so this is not the reason for failing to obtain SCHIP coverage.
3. Families have adequate time to complete the enrollment process, but some do not believe they will qualify, and so do not try to enroll.
4. Parents do value medical interventions for their children, but some do not believe they can qualify, believing that their income is too high.

Answer to Question 2

1
Rationale 1: The most common cause of death for children between 1 and 19 years of age is unintentional injury, which includes motor vehicle crashes, drowning, fire, burns, firearms, and suffocation.
Rationale 2: Infectious disease is not the cause of most deaths in children.
Rationale 3: The leading cause of death in children is unintentional injuries, not congenital anomalies.
Rationale 4: Cancer is not the leading cause of child mortality.
